What Are Heat Moldable Insoles?
Heat moldable insoles are designed to conform to the unique shape of your foot. They’re made from materials that soften when heated, allowing them to be molded to your individual foot contours. This process creates a custom-like fit, aiming to enhance comfort, support, and alignment within your shoe.
These insoles often feature a core material that becomes pliable with heat. This could be a blend of polymers, foams, or other materials. The heat-molding process ensures the insole perfectly matches your foot’s arch, heel, and overall shape. This is in contrast to standard insoles, which offer a generic fit.
Key Components and Materials
Heat moldable insoles commonly use the following materials:
- Thermo-moldable core: This is the heart of the insole, the part that softens with heat and molds to your foot. Common materials include EVA foam, various polymers, and sometimes a blend of materials.
- Top cover: This layer provides a comfortable surface against your foot. It’s often made of breathable materials like fabric or moisture-wicking textiles to reduce friction and manage sweat.
- Base layer: This provides structure and support to the insole. It helps maintain the insole’s shape and durability, and may include features like arch support or cushioning.
How They Differ From Standard Insoles
Standard insoles are mass-produced and designed to fit a wide range of foot shapes. They offer a general level of cushioning and support, but they don’t conform to your unique foot structure. This can lead to less effective support and potential discomfort.
Heat moldable insoles, on the other hand, provide a personalized fit. The custom molding process ensures the insole supports your foot’s specific needs. This can lead to improved comfort, reduced pressure points, and better alignment.
The Heat Molding Process: Step-by-Step
Molding a heat moldable insole is generally straightforward. The exact steps may vary depending on the manufacturer, so always follow the instructions provided with your specific insoles. However, the basic process involves these steps:
- Heating the Insoles: This is typically done in an oven or with a hairdryer. The manufacturer’s instructions will specify the temperature and time required. Make sure to use a safe method.
- Inserting the Insoles into Your Shoes: Place the heated insoles into your shoes. Ensure the insole is flat and properly positioned within the shoe.
- Standing on the Insoles: Put your feet into the shoes with the heated insoles. Stand for the recommended time, usually a few minutes. This allows the insole to mold to your foot shape.
- Allowing the Insoles to Cool: After standing, remove your feet and allow the insoles to cool and harden. This sets the mold and creates the custom fit.
Safety Precautions During Molding
Always prioritize safety when heating and molding your insoles. Here are some key precautions:
- Follow Instructions Carefully: Read and understand the manufacturer’s instructions before starting.
- Use the Recommended Heating Method: Stick to the recommended heating method (oven, hairdryer, etc.) and temperature.
- Avoid Overheating: Overheating can damage the insoles and potentially the shoes.
- Use Oven Mitts or Heat-Resistant Gloves: When handling hot insoles, protect your hands.
- Supervise Children: Keep children away from the heating process.
Troubleshooting Common Issues
Sometimes, the molding process doesn’t go perfectly. Here are some common issues and how to address them:
- Insole Doesn’t Mold Properly: If the insole doesn’t mold, you may not have heated it enough. Repeat the heating process, ensuring you follow the instructions precisely.
- Insole Feels Too Tight: If the insole feels too tight after molding, you might have stood on it for too long. Try remolding it with a shorter standing time.
- Insole Feels Uncomfortable: If the insole is still uncomfortable after molding, it may not be the right shape for your foot. Consider trying a different type of insole or consulting a podiatrist.

Potential Drawbacks and Considerations
While heat moldable insoles offer many benefits, it’s important to be aware of potential drawbacks and considerations before purchasing them:
Cost
Heat moldable insoles can be more expensive than standard insoles. The materials and manufacturing process often contribute to a higher price point. Consider your budget and whether the benefits justify the cost.
Molding Process Time and Effort
The heat molding process requires time and effort. You’ll need to heat the insoles, insert them into your shoes, and stand on them for a specific period. This process can be inconvenient, especially if you need to mold multiple pairs of insoles.
Fit Issues
Although heat moldable insoles are designed to conform to your foot, there’s always a possibility of fit issues. If the insole doesn’t mold properly or feels uncomfortable after molding, you might need to try remolding or consider a different type of insole.
Durability
The lifespan of heat moldable insoles can vary depending on the materials and usage. Some insoles may wear out faster than others, especially if used for high-impact activities. Be prepared to replace them periodically.
Not a Cure-All
Heat moldable insoles can provide relief and support, but they’re not a cure-all for all foot problems. They may not be effective for all conditions, and you might need additional treatments or interventions for certain issues.
Not Suitable for All Shoe Types
Heat moldable insoles may not be suitable for all types of shoes, especially those with limited space. Ensure the insoles fit comfortably in your shoes without causing overcrowding or discomfort.
Potential for Incorrect Molding
If you don’t follow the molding instructions carefully, you might end up with an improperly molded insole that doesn’t provide the desired support or comfort. It’s crucial to follow the instructions precisely to ensure a proper fit.
May Require Break-in Period
Even with custom molding, you might need a break-in period to get used to the insoles. Your feet might initially feel slightly different or uncomfortable. Gradually increase the amount of time you wear the insoles to allow your feet to adapt.
Comparison with Other Insoles
Understanding how heat moldable insoles compare to other types of insoles can help you make an informed decision. Here’s a comparison:
Vs. Standard Insoles
Standard Insoles: Mass-produced, generic fit, offer basic cushioning and support. Generally less expensive. Less effective at addressing specific foot needs or providing customized support.
Heat Moldable Insoles: Custom-molded for a personalized fit, offer enhanced comfort, support, and alignment. More expensive. Provide better support for specific foot problems and activities.
Vs. Custom Orthotics
Custom Orthotics: Prescribed by a podiatrist, made from a mold of your foot, offer the highest level of customization and support. Typically more expensive and require a doctor’s visit. (See Also: Will Insoles Make Me Taller )
Heat Moldable Insoles: Provide a good level of customization, more affordable than custom orthotics, and can be molded at home. May not offer the same level of precision as custom orthotics.
Vs. Gel Insoles
Gel Insoles: Offer excellent cushioning and shock absorption, often used for comfort and impact protection. May not provide the same level of arch support or alignment as heat moldable insoles.
Heat Moldable Insoles: Provide a balance of cushioning, support, and customized fit. Offer better arch support and alignment compared to gel insoles.
Vs. Pre-Molded Insoles
Pre-Molded Insoles: Offer pre-defined arch support and cushioning, often designed for specific foot types. Provide a step up from standard insoles, but not as customized as heat moldable options.
Heat Moldable Insoles: Offer a higher level of customization, molding to the unique shape of your foot, for a more personalized fit.
Caring for Your Heat Moldable Insoles
Proper care and maintenance are crucial to extend the life of your heat moldable insoles and ensure they continue to provide optimal support and comfort. Here’s how to care for your insoles:
Cleaning and Maintenance
Regularly clean your insoles to remove dirt, sweat, and odors. Wipe them down with a damp cloth and mild soap. Avoid harsh chemicals or abrasive cleaners, which can damage the materials. Allow them to air dry completely before reinserting them into your shoes.
Storage
When you’re not using your insoles, store them in a cool, dry place away from direct sunlight and extreme temperatures. This helps to preserve the materials and prevent them from warping or deteriorating.
Inspection
Regularly inspect your insoles for signs of wear and tear, such as cracks, compression, or loss of support. Replace them if you notice any damage or if they no longer provide adequate support or comfort. The lifespan of your insoles depends on usage and care.
Rotation
If you have multiple pairs of shoes, consider rotating your insoles between them. This can help extend their lifespan and ensure even wear. Allow your insoles to dry out completely between uses.
Avoid Extreme Heat
Avoid exposing your insoles to extreme heat, such as direct sunlight or a hot car. This can damage the materials and affect their performance. Store them in a moderate temperature environment.
Replace as Needed
Replace your insoles when they show signs of wear, such as loss of cushioning, compression, or a change in shape. The lifespan of your insoles depends on usage and the quality of the materials. Replacing them regularly ensures continued support and comfort.
